Micro Service - Mega Cost: Architectural Styles and Their Hidden Price Tags

As developers, we love debating monoliths vs. microservices, event-driven vs. REST, serverless vs. Kubernetes. But beyond scalability, isolation, productivity, and other engineering trade-offs, there is a less glamorous, yet critical, dimension to these choices: cost.
In this talk, I’ll share real-world lessons from my experience building cloud-native systems and uncover the hidden price tags behind popular architectural styles. We'll break down the surprising costs of microservices, the savings (or not?) of monoliths, the trade-offs of serverless, and how an event-driven system can affect the budget.
This talk will give you a practical lens for evaluating architecture not just by performance or maintainability, but by the unexpected financial impact that comes with scale.
